We have been dining at Ohana's for years now and we were very worried about the menu change but we thought that expect for taking away the shrimp wontons that all of the changes were good. We didn't like that the apple sauce was gone either. The new dessert was a HUGH improvement in our opinion over the old pineapple. I can have pineapple at home but I sure can't make that bread pudding at home. It was fabulous.
I thought the old menu was getting a little tired for lack of a better term. I think taking away the lazy susans was stupid, I liked the gimmick! To me it is like when Cape May took away the silver buckets. I loved those silver buckets, I don't know why they got rid of those either.
Anyway, I am rambling now, give Ohana's a try and make up your own opinion. I think its one of the better Disney restaurants of that caliber.
